Thailand IVF fee
Test tube baby technology has gradually become popular in Thailand, attracting many patients at home and abroad. However, the cost of IVF in Thailand can vary due to various factors. The following will elaborate on these influencing factors from four aspects: medical equipment and technology, hospital location, doctor experience and technology, and additional costs.

Medical equipment and technology
Some hospitals in Thailand have invested in advanced medical equipment and technology, which will directly affect the cost of IVF. Advanced equipment and technology can improve the success rate of IVF, and reduce patients' waiting time and medical risks. Therefore, these hospitals usually charge higher fees to compensate for the operation and maintenance costs of equipment and technology.
However, not all hospitals can provide the most advanced equipment and technology. Some relatively simple medical equipment and technology may not be competent for complex IVF surgery, resulting in a low success rate. The cost of IVF in these hospitals is relatively low, but patients need to bear risks and possible failures.
Geographic location of the hospital
The cost of IVF will also vary in different geographical locations in Thailand. Hospitals in some major cities in Thailand, such as Bangkok and Chiang Mai, often charge higher fees because these cities have more developed medical facilities and services. Patients who choose these cities for IVF surgery may have to pay more.
In contrast, some hospitals in rural areas may charge lower fees. However, the equipment and technology of these hospitals may be relatively simple, and doctors' experience is relatively limited. When patients decide to go to these hospitals for IVF surgery, they need to balance the cost and medical quality.
Doctor experience and skills
The experience and technology of doctors are also an important factor affecting the cost of IVF. Some experienced doctors may be able to provide higher success rates and better postoperative care, so patients usually need to pay higher fees to obtain their services.
However, not all doctors have the same experience and technical level. Some newly graduated doctors may lack practical experience, so their costs are relatively low. However, patients should consider the experience and skills of doctors, not just the cost, when deciding to choose a doctor.
Additional charges
In addition to the cost of IVF surgery itself, there are some additional costs that will also affect the total cost. These costs include drug costs, nursing costs, blood testing costs, etc. Some hospitals will charge additional consultation fees or service fees before or after IVF surgery.
In addition, some patients may need multiple IVF operations to successfully conceive, which will increase the total cost. When choosing hospitals and making treatment plans, patients need to fully understand and calculate these additional costs to ensure that the budget is met.
